The breeding season is supposed to have commenced, though many of us think: wait, it's still winter. HOWEVER last night at about 5 pm, two herons were indeed circling and croaking just south of the heronry.
I hope this is a sign that breeding activity is set to re-commence on the west side.
If that occurs, then let's also hope that construction does not (luckily the economic picture does not look bright for new construction). Or that construction can take place when the herons aren't on their nests. It would seem to be a great asset for the townhomes, to have a heronry nearby.
In the meantime, other people who see signs of breeding activity should send it in.
